Happy Independence Day Indonesia!

Today is Indonesia’s 64th Independence Day. We had most of the day off, with the exception of a flag ceremony students and teachers were required to attend. It reminded me of my elementary school days in Mexico. We stood in lines, all facing the flag, we were instructed to salute, stand at ease, stand at attention, stand at ease, salute again. I didn’t really understand, so I just followed what other teachers were doing around me. We sang national songs, I listened, and we counted the drops of sweat dripping off our foreheads as we stood under the hot sun. Independence day is celebrated in each little neighborhood by playing games with all the kids. This is a picture in my neighborhood of kids having a decorated bike contest. It looked like they were going to race, but I didn’t stay around for all of the festivities.
